WIFI ELM327 V1.5 OBD2 auto scan tool for Android, iOS.
Hardware V1.5, Software V2.1.
WIFI OBD2 can automatically detect and interpret various protocols.
It also provides support for high-speed communication and a low-power sleep mode.
It uses AT commands to communicate with a host device (PC, Notebook, iPhone, iPod touch, iPad, Android, etc.).
Numerous software packages are available that are fully compatible with WI-FI OBD2.
Some of them have quite useful functions, such as monitoring engine operating parameters, reading and deleting DTCs, MPG meter, etc.
You can also write your own software on a specific hardware platform if you wish, because the AT commands are fully documented and very well explained.

Wifi OBD ELM327 Specifications:
SSID: WiFi_OBDII
IP: 192.168.0.10
Subnet: 255.255.255.0
Port: 35000
Range: 50 m
Antenna: internal
Power consumption: 0.75 watts (with power switch)
Wifi standard: 802.11a / b / g
Operating temperature: -15 to 100 degrees Celsius
Plastic: automotive grade

Supported protocols:
1. SAE J1850 PWM (41.6 Kbaud)
2. SAE J1850 VPW (10.4 Kbaud)
3. ISO 9141-2 (5 baud init, 10.4 Kbaud)
4. ISO14230-4 KWP (5 baud init, 10.4 Kbaud)
5. ISO14230-4 KWP (fast init, 10.4 Kbaud)
6. ISO15765-4 CAN (11bit ID, 500 Kbaud)
7. ISO15765-4 CAN (29bit ID, 500 Kbaud)
8. ISO15765-4 CAN (11bit ID, 250 Kbaud)
9. ISO15765-4 CAN (29bit ID, 250 Kbaud)

Instructions for connecting Android devices:
1. go to settings, WI-FI and connect with the OBD2 device

2. open the application (Torque, ect.), you have to open the settings after OBD adapter settings, select Wi-Fi, go back and check the status of the adapter.

Instructions for connecting IOS devices:
1. Activate WI-FI
2. Connect with OBD2
3. Open APP (Torque), click on "Connect", connect with WI-FI
